How does an engineered septic system work?

An engineered septic tank functions via a collection of steps, making sure effective wastewater therapy:

Collection: Wastewater from your home moves into the septic tank. Treatment: Inside the storage tank, solids resolve at the bottom, while lighter products develop a layer of scum on top. Flow Distribution: The treated effluent steps into a drainage area or alternate treatment area for additional filtration. Final Dispersal: Clean water is taken in back right into the ground, benefiting the environment.

Types of Engineered Septic Systems

There are several sorts of crafted septic tanks created to accommodate various requirements:

    Conventional Septic Systems: Standard configurations for fundamental wastewater management. Sand Filter Systems: Usage sand layers to filter effluent prior to it enters the water drainage field. Mound Systems: Elevated systems perfect for areas with inadequate dirt drainage or high groundwater levels. Aerobic Treatment Units: Utilize cardiovascular microorganisms to improve treatment, appropriate for portable spaces.

Conventional septic systems

Conventional septic systems include a septic tank and a drainpipe area. Crucial elements include:

    Septic Tank: A sealed container that permits solids to settle and treat wastewater. Drain Field: A series of perforated pipes that disperse effluent for natural soil filtration. Design Criteria: Have to adhere to regional wellness codes to make certain appropriate sewer disposal.

Sand filter systems

Sand filter systems are engineered septic tanks that make use of sand to treat wastewater. Trick benefits include:

    Effective Filtration: Sand functions as an all-natural filter, enhancing effluent quality. Space Efficiency: Can fit in smaller sized locations where conventional systems may not work. Adaptability: Ideal for numerous soil types and locations.

Mound systems

Mound systems supply an alternate septic solution, particularly in tough settings. Their features consist of:

    Elevation: Placed above all-natural ground degree for ample drainage. Layered Design: Made up of sand and crushed rock to help in effluent therapy and absorption. Site-Specific: Suitable for properties with high groundwater tables or inadequate drain conditions.

Aerobic treatment units

Aerobic treatment units (ATUs) represent a modern-day strategy in septic modern technology, boosting wastewater treatment. Attributes include:

    Aeration Process: Uses oxygen to damage down organic matter more effectively. Reduced Footprint: Portable layouts that fit restricted rooms well. High Performance: Capable of treating bigger volumes of wastewater with far better effluent quality.

FAQs

    How usually needs to I examine my engineered septic system?
      It's best to evaluate your system every year and pump the container every 3 to 5 years.
    What are the signs of a failing septic system?
      Watch out for nasty smells, damp spots in your lawn, and slow-moving drains inside your home.
    Are crafted septic systems a lot more costly than traditional ones?
      Initial prices may be higher, however long-lasting financial savings on upkeep and environmental advantages make them a sensible choice.
